Houston-area restaurants, businesses allowed to increase capacity as Covid hospitalizations decline

This story is courtesy of our partners at KHOU 11. Click here for KHOU’s story, and click here for more coronavirus coverage from KHOU.

HOUSTON — With Covid-19 hospitalizations dropping across the region, restaurants and certain businesses are free to welcome back more customers, and indoor bars can open back up. But when it comes to bars, they can reopen only if the county judge allows it.
